How MBAs Can Lead in the Age of Data-Driven Decision Making Introduction In today’s business world, data is the new oil and like oil, it needs to be refined to be useful. Companies are swimming in data, from customer behavior and sales numbers to supply chain metrics and social media trends. But having data is not enough. What truly matters is making smart decisions based on that data. This is where the role of modern MBA graduates becomes incredibly valuable. 3. Making Decisions with Confidence: Making decisions when it is backed by strong data and proof brings in more confidence. For instance, your company chooses to enter a new domain in the market. Data regarding customer demands, competitor presence, pricing benchmarks, and economic trends can help you come to a more informed and precise decision. 4. Effective Communication of Insights: One of the most underrated but crucial skills for MBAs in the age of data is the ability to communicate data-driven insights effectively. It's not enough to understand the numbers—you must be able to tell a compelling story with them. 5. Leading Data-Driven Teams: As an MBA graduate, you’ll likely be managing teams that include data analysts, marketers, engineers, and salespeople.
